Community Water Grants
As a result of the Australian Government 2008/09 Budget, there will be no further funding rounds of the Community Water Grants program. This will not affect the delivery of the many worthwhile Community Water Grants projects already approved which are helping the community take action to use water more wisely.
About Community Water Grants
The Community Water Grants program funded projects involving local communities that will result in wise water use.
